Abstract
XPS spectra of a series of iodide salts of stilbazolium-type cations were r ecorded at the N1s core level. Analysis of the spectra, supported by ab ini tio calculations, revealed a great sensitivity of the charge distribution o n the central part of the chromophores and a strong donor-acceptor intramol ecular charge transfer leading to unusually intense shake-up satellite peak s. After intercalation in the MnPS3 layered phase, the XPS spectra of the c hromophores showed a perturbation of their electronic distribution, this ef fect being especially significant for those containing a central imine doub le bond. These results are consistent with previous studies concerning the formation of stilbazolium J-aggregates in the interlamellar space of the ho st lattice.
